MBCC Young Professionals

  

Who We Are

We are a group of single young adults in Birmingham, AL seeking to follow Christ with our whole hearts. Our goal is to grow in Christ as we seek to love God and love others. Mostly in our 20s and early 30s, we focus on what it means to follow Christ and serve his church as we forge into our careers and life circumstances.

 

 

 

 

 

 

 What We Do

MBCC Young Professionals is a great place to plug into the life of our church, to become a vital part of the church community. We are building a network of small groups that meet throughout the week. These growth groups also gather all together on Sunday morning for Community Group in room G-202. We also prioritize active involvement in Christ’s local and global mission. And, we like to just have fun together through meals, parties, trips, retreats, etc.

Reach Out--Become the hands and feet of Jesus by serving others.
-Locally, we have a number of opportunities to serve. The goal is to develop lasting relationships to help further the Kingdom of God as we build bridges through which we can share the gospel. Our primary focus locally is on the Fairfield Community Garden, a project started by our Young Professionals group. Click here for more information.

-Globally, we work with MBCC global mission partners to help carry the gospel to locations around the world. We do this by participating in short-term mission trips, praying for our mission partners, and completing various projects to encourage and support the global partners.
